Super Eagles receive Presidential award from President Bola Tinubu

The Super Eagles of Nigeria were hosted by President Bola Ahmed Tinubu after the team finished in second place at the just concluded 2023 Africa Cup of Nations.

The three-time AFCON winner was hosted at the State House Council Chambers in Abuja on Tuesday, February 13, 2024, only a few hours after the players arrived in Nigeria from Abidjan. Nigeria lost the final game 2-1 against Cote d'Ivoire which was played on Sunday, February 11, 2024.

All members of the Super Eagles team have been awarded with the Member of the Order of Niger (MON) by the President of Nigeria, Bola Tinubu, a flat each and a plot of land in the Federal Capital Territory.

Nigeria took the lead in the match after William Troost-Ekong scored a beautiful header in the first half, but Franck Kessie and Sebastien Haller scored in the second half which gave the Ivorians the trophy.

The Super Eagles arrived in the country in the early hours of Tuesday, they were welcomed by a crowd of people with Nigerian flags at the airport. The fans clapped and cheered as the players descended from the plane.
